Son in law has a 97 Explorer XLT 4.0L/auto/4x4 180K miles
Making clunking noise when turning, binding up at times when truck is warm
So over x mas break:
I checked out his CV shafts, original CV's at 180K miles, they were loose loose.
I had some CV's laying around with half the miles, so we installed those, same issue
I got under the truck, no looseness in the front end, driveshaft, t case, anywhere
IN fact it looks great for 180K miles
So I did the brown wire mod, took 12 minutes to do with the help of the Exploreforum
Noise and binding are GONE with the switch off = front d shaft disconnected = noise gone.
My guess is his driveshaft is on its way out, though no visable slop or tears, play, etc
Next we are going to drain and fill the 4405 t case, my guess is the 180K mile fluid is BLACK
Plan for this truck is a 1354 manual conversion, he is saving $$$ for this now, so we are trying to avoid having to buy a $160 driveshaft in the next two-three weeks
Brown wire mod = worth a shot! Of course if it snows his truck will be right back to binding and popping because he will need his front d shaft, but at least we bought some time to locate a 1354 manual and linkage! also a 97 2wd GEM
